Persistent social media speculation about a third pregnancy for Kylie Jenner, frequently tied to her relationship with Timothée Chalamet, has circulated in 2026 without any official confirmation or credible reporting. No public statements from Jenner, her representatives, or family members have emerged to support the claims, and verified outlets continue to describe the chatter as unverified rumors. Traders interpret this ongoing absence of announcements or visible developments as strong evidence that confirmation is unlikely before year-end, especially given the pattern of similar past speculation being addressed privately or not at all. Upcoming public appearances or social media activity could shift sentiment, but the current lack of substantiated signals underpins the market's heavy weighting toward no confirmation.

Only credible announcements will qualify. Pregnancy announcements that are not credible, for example jokes, will not suffice.
The resolution source will be statements from Kylie Jenner or her representatives; however, a definitive consensus of credible media reporting may be considered.
